Output 53aae1966a67aa00a9956eaf07461b0b29b7069195997681cbb5720dcf8e636b:0

value
23102984
script pubkey
OP_0 OP_PUSHBYTES_20 b50a8d38cb4b38dd6c331c1aa34124f72fbd14a6
address
bc1qk59g6wxtfvud6mpnrsd2xsfy7uhm699xzsrh8v
transaction
53aae1966a67aa00a9956eaf07461b0b29b7069195997681cbb5720dcf8e636b
confirmations
421005
spent
true